Running the maven command: mvn release:branch -DbranchName=$/NNG/ORK/maven-branch-10 invokes finally tf branch D:\Dev\projects\NNG\ORK\dev\PLS -checkin $/NNG/ORK/maven-branch-10 this causes an error: {color:red}âTF10125: The path must start with $/â{color} After a research I found the *checkin* statement causes this problem, because if I comment out the "checkin" argument (in {{org.apache.maven.scm.provider.tfs.command.TfsBranchCommand}}), it works fine. However, we _do_ want to use the "checkin" statement because we want the new branch to be checked-in. I found out that it will be OK to use "checkin", only if we use a TFS path (starts with '$/'), instead of local-path.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.1.6#6162)
